Former Ukrainian Official Assassinated in Madrid

Former Ukrainian presidential advisor Andrii Portnov, sanctioned by the US in 2021 for corruption and human rights abuses, was assassinated in Madrid on Wednesday, sparking an investigation into his financial activities and political ties.

EU Parliament Seeks Immunity Lifting for Five MEPs in Huawei Scandal

European Parliament President Roberto Metsola requested the lifting of immunity for five MEPs—three from the EPP, one Socialist, and one Renew Europe—linked to an alleged Huawei bribery and lobbying scandal; the MEPs deny wrongdoing, and the investigation will proceed.

Boric's Approval Rating Plummets Amidst Rising Crime and Unmet Reform Promises

Chilean President Gabriel Boric's approval rating has plummeted from 30% to 22% in recent polls, driven by urban, younger, educated voters' dissatisfaction with his administration's handling of key issues like security, immigration, and unfulfilled promises regarding major reforms.

Ecuador's Top Prosecutor Resigns Amid Death Threats

Diana Salazar, Ecuador's Attorney General for six years, resigned on Tuesday, citing death threats. Her tenure was marked by high-profile convictions in corruption and drug trafficking cases, including those involving former President Rafael Correa and Vice President Jorge Glas.

Trump's Crypto Auction Raises Foreign Influence Concerns

President Trump auctioned a private dinner via his Trump-branded cryptocurrency, with the majority of top investors appearing to be foreign, including a Chinese-born crypto mogul facing fraud charges, raising concerns about foreign influence and potential ethical violations.

Huawei Lobbying Scandal Shakes European Parliament

A Belgian investigation into alleged bribery by Huawei to influence EU policy led to multiple arrests, searches of parliament offices, and a temporary ban on Huawei lobbyists; charges include corruption, money laundering, and participation in a criminal organization.

Mexican Party Movimiento Ciudadano Faces Multiple Drug Cartel-Related Scandals

Movimiento Ciudadano (MC) in Mexico faces multiple scandals involving local officials linked to drug cartels, including arrests, murders, and allegations of cartel-linked gift-giving, undermining their "new politics" platform.

Thai Court Orders Yingluck Shinawatra to Pay \$300 Million for Rice Subsidy Losses

A Thai court ordered former Prime Minister Yingluck Shinawatra to pay over \$300 million in compensation for losses incurred by a failed rice subsidy program implemented during her 2011-2014 tenure; the court found her negligent, despite the government recouping losses through rice sales.

Mass Jailbreak in New Orleans: Five Recaptured, State Audit Ordered

Ten inmates escaped from the Orleans Justice Center in New Orleans on Friday after a maintenance worker allegedly helped them; five have been recaptured, prompting a state audit of the jail due to outdated security and infrastructure.
